Items marked ✓ are shipped. your theme / essentials" flow (ties into the branding work). ## Known issues & follow-ups +- ✓ **Waybar crash on theme switch left the session bar-less** (Latitude + hardware QA, 2026-07-04): exec-once has no supervisor, so any crash + orphaned the session until relogin — and the switch path itself was + crash-prone: `reload_style_on_change` (inotify on style.css) and + theme-sync's SIGUSR2 both fired while the HM symlinks flipped, a + double-reload race in waybar's in-place reload. Fix: (1) the bar runs + under a `nomarchy-waybar` supervisor (waybar.nix) — ANY exit respawns + it, with a crash-loop guard (5 fast exits → critical notification, + stop); (2) theme-sync now prefers a clean `pkill -x waybar` when it + sees the supervisor (a restart with fresh config+style — no reload + code path at all), keeping SIGUSR2 only as the fallback for + unsupervised/custom bars; `reload_style_on_change` stays for manual + `home-update` restyles. VM-verified on the headless software-GL + desktop: SIGKILL → new pid; clean kill → respawn; SIGUSR2 → alive. +- ✓ **`sys-rebuild`** (Latitude QA request): the no-update twin of + `sys-update` — snapshot-first system rebuild against the *current* + lock, for config-only changes; `home-update` was already lock-free. + README §3/§5 + the motd list all three. - ✓ **Yazi TOML parse error on startup:** yazi 26.x made fetchers' `group` field required, so `[[plugin.prepend_fetchers]]` failed to parse and yazi fell back to presets. Via the nomarchy-waybar supervisor (waybar.nix): a crash — or + # the clean pkill a theme switch now does — respawns the bar instead + # of orphaning the session bar-less. + ] ++ lib.optional config.nomarchy.waybar.enable "nomarchy-waybar" ++ lib.optional kbAutoSwitch "${keyboardWatch}/bin/nomarchy-keyboard-watch"; # ── Theme-driven look ────────────────────────────────────────── diff --git a/modules/home/waybar.nix b/modules/home/waybar.nix index e2b674e..a1b0cd9 100644 --- a/modules/home/waybar.nix +++ b/modules/home/waybar.nix @@ -28,6 +28,37 @@ let # Named writeShellScriptBins (put on PATH via home.packages below) rather # than bare writeShellScript store paths, so the whole-swap themes' static # waybar.jsonc can exec them by name too — same as the swaync bell. + # Waybar supervisor — exec-once has no restart, so a crashed bar used to + # leave the session bar-less until relogin (seen on hardware: a theme + # switch crashed waybar mid-reload). Respawns on ANY exit — a plain + # `pkill -x waybar` is now a clean restart, which nomarchy-theme-sync + # uses instead of the crash-prone in-place SIGUSR2 reload when it sees + # this supervisor running. Crash-loop guard: 5 exits within 10s of + # their start → give up with a critical notification instead of + # spinning. Stop the bar for real: pkill -f nomarchy-waybar (TERM is + # trapped to take the child down too). + waybarSupervisor = pkgs.writeShellScriptBin "nomarchy-waybar" '' + child= + trap '[ -n "$child" ] && kill "$child" 2>/dev/null; exit 0' TERM INT + fails=0 + while :; do + start=$(date +%s) + waybar & child=$! + wait "$child"; code=$? + if [ $(( $(date +%s) - start )) -lt 10 ]; then + fails=$((fails + 1)) + if [ "$fails" -ge 5 ]; then + notify-send -u critical "Waybar" \ + "Crashing on start (exit $code) — check ~/.config/waybar. Giving up." 2>/dev/null + exit 1 + fi + else + fails=0 + fi + sleep 1 + done + ''; + powerProfileStatus = pkgs.writeShellScriptBin "nomarchy-powerprofile-status" '' case "$(ls /sys/class/power_supply/ 2>/dev/null)" in *BAT*) ;; *) exit 0 ;; esac command -v powerprofilesctl >/dev/null 2>&1 || exit 0 @@ -308,7 +339,8 @@ in }; # The power-profile helpers on PATH, so both the generated bar and the - # whole-swap themes' static waybar.jsonc can exec them by name. + # whole-swap themes' static waybar.jsonc can exec them by name — plus + # the supervisor hyprland.nix exec-onces. home.packages = lib.optionals config.nomarchy.waybar.enable - [ powerProfileStatus powerProfileCycle vpnStatus ]; + [ waybarSupervisor powerProfileStatus powerProfileCycle vpnStatus ]; } diff --git a/modules/nixos/default.nix b/modules/nixos/default.nix index bd240fc..c9488ca 100644 --- a/modules/nixos/default.nix +++ b/modules/nixos/default.nix @@ -53,6 +53,7 @@ in ${distroName} — a NixOS desktop, themed from one JSON. sys-update update inputs + rebuild the system + sys-rebuild rebuild the system, no input update home-update apply home/theme changes (no sudo) nomarchy-theme-sync apply switch the whole palette SUPER+? keybindings cheatsheet @@ -312,6 +313,23 @@ in sudo nixos-rebuild switch --flake "$flake#default" "$@" fi '') + # The no-update twin (hardware-QA request): rebuild the system + # against the CURRENT lock — config changes only, no `nix flake + # update` — mirroring how home-update never touches the lock. + # Same snapshot-first path when available. + (pkgs.writeShellScriptBin "sys-rebuild" '' + set -e + if [ "$(id -u)" -eq 0 ]; then + echo "sys-rebuild: run as your normal user (it sudos the rebuild itself)" >&2 + exit 1 + fi + flake="''${NOMARCHY_PATH:-$HOME/.nomarchy}" + if command -v nixos-rebuild-snap >/dev/null 2>&1; then + sudo nixos-rebuild-snap "$@" # BTRFS snapshot first + else + sudo nixos-rebuild switch --flake "$flake#default" "$@" + fi + '') (pkgs.writeShellScriptBin "home-update" '' set -e exec home-manager switch --flake "''${NOMARCHY_PATH:-$HOME/.nomarchy}" "$@" diff --git a/pkgs/nomarchy-theme-sync/nomarchy-theme-sync.py b/pkgs/nomarchy-theme-sync/nomarchy-theme-sync.py index efe0a3e..5f048d9 100644 --- a/pkgs/nomarchy-theme-sync/nomarchy-theme-sync.py +++ b/pkgs/nomarchy-theme-sync/nomarchy-theme-sync.py @@ -204,11 +204,22 @@ def run_switch() -> None: notify("Rebuild FAILED — see terminal / journal", urgency="critical") die("rebuild failed (state file already updated; fix and re-run)") notify("Changes applied ✓") - # Waybar runs from Hyprland's exec-once (not a systemd unit HM would restart - # on switch), so nudge the running bar to re-read its freshly rebuilt - # config/style.
